找回密码
 立即注册

QQ登录

只需一步,快速开始

Liuping

金牌服务用户

10

主题

25

帖子

83

积分

金牌服务用户

积分
83
Liuping
金牌服务用户   /  发表于:2020-10-9 21:12  /   查看:2275  /  回复:3
本帖最后由 Liuping 于 2020-10-9 21:17 编辑

RT,有没有事件能在内容发生任何形式的变化时触发呢?我这边需要实现一个有变更后的保存提醒弹层,需要做变更的监听。
看了下 API 文档,变更的事件太多太细了,有没有一个或几个事件就能涵盖所有变更的

3 个回复

倒序浏览
Fiooona
论坛元老   /  发表于:2020-10-10 08:27:43
沙发
单元格值改变可以同时监听ValueChange 和RangeChanged事件,
这个需求还可能用到单元格状态,脏数据功能,请参考:
image.png12568053.png
https://demo.grapecity.com.cn/sp ... /dirty-items/purejs
https://demo.grapecity.com.cn/sp ... introduction/purejs
组件化表格编辑器(预览版)试用进行中,点击了解详情!
请点击评分,对我的服务做出评价!5分为非常满意!
回复 使用道具 举报
Liuping
金牌服务用户   /  发表于:2020-10-10 10:42:21
板凳
Fiooona 发表于 2020-10-10 08:27
单元格值改变可以同时监听ValueChange 和RangeChanged事件,
这个需求还可能用到单元格状态,脏数据功能, ...

你这个方式只是能监听单元格变更吧,excel 内容变更远不止这些吧,还有拆入了浮层元素、新增了 sheet 等等,这些你说的方式根本监听不到吧
回复 使用道具 举报
Fiooona
论坛元老   /  发表于:2020-10-10 11:45:56
地板
上面的回复针对单元格值的改变,
如果要是对表单样式,插入浮动元素等操作进行监听,没有统一的事件能监听,建议 直接对比 spread.toJSON 后的JSON字符串,比较前后的JSON 是否有差异。
组件化表格编辑器(预览版)试用进行中,点击了解详情!
请点击评分,对我的服务做出评价!5分为非常满意!
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 立即注册
返回顶部